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 6-K filing by Sequans Communications S.A. reports on the results of the combined ordinary and extraordinary meeting of shareholders held on June 30, 2017. The filing serves to disclose corporate governance actions and shareholder voting outcomes rather than operational financial performance for a specific quarter.

Material Changes and Shareholder Actions
- Voting Participation: 30,617,219 ordinary shares (40.64% of outstanding shares) were voted at the meeting.
- Proposal Outcomes: Shareholders approved all proposals except Proposal 16, which sought to authorize a capital increase reserved for employees.
- Board Composition: Messrs. Yves Maitre and Hubert de Pesquidoux were re-elected. Ms. Mailys Ferrere was elected as a new director.
- Capital Authority: The Board was authorized to issue stock subscription warrants, options, and restricted free shares, with an overall ceiling of 1,500,000 for options and warrants. Additionally, the Board received authority to carry out a capital increase up to a maximum nominal amount of €800,000 for specific classes of persons.
